Honoring our Heritage

Friday, July 30th our family received a great honor. Our business was inducted into the California Agricultural Heritage Club. This is an award honoring….”California farms, ranches, organizations and agribusinesses that have preserved an economic liability in the state with a bare requirement of at least one entire century. Applicants are entailed to submit a completed application and documentation providing proof of ownership over the last 100 years.” As many of you have heard us tell, our property on Harney Lane was purchased by Fred Schnaidt, George’s great grandfather, in 1900. Then in the first decade of the 1900’s Henry Schnaidt, George’s grandfather and mentor, planted the first grapes on the property.  And we know that atleast part of the first plantings WERE winegrapes, not table grapes. Henry and Elizabeth (pictured above) also built the family home on the property.  What a great legacy our family gave us that is now in its 110th year!!!!
It the fast paced world we live in, it really is an honor and an achievement to sustain a business that long, especially in the same location. The kids, “Lizzy” and “James”, are now the 6th generation living on the property.  And while we are greatful for this legacy, we hope that the previous generations would be proud of not only our vineyards but of our newest venture, Harney Lane!
